    What are FAKRA Z Coaxial Connectors?

    FAKRA Z connectors are a special type of coaxial connector. They are made for high-frequency tasks. These connectors work well with electrical signals. They can be used in wireless systems, radar, and fast data transfer. Each FAKRA connector has a unique shape and build. This helps them connect properly and send signals well. Their quick-plug design makes them easy to set up and fix.

    Design and Structure

    FAKRA Z connectors are built to be strong and reliable. They have a lock that stops them from coming apart by accident, which is important in cars. The connectors keep a 50Ω impedance, which means they keep signal quality good from DC to 6GHz. This makes them work with many devices, so they are useful in today's tech.

    Resistance to Environmental Factors

    These connectors handle weather well. They work from -40°C to +105°C. This means they perform in hot or cold places. Their tough design keeps out water, dust, and shakes, common in cars. This helps them send signals without stopping.

    Comparing FAKRA Z with Other Connector Types

    Key Differences

    Design Variations

    FAKRA Z connectors have a special design for high-frequency tasks. They are better than FAKRA A and FAKRA F in wireless systems, radar, and fast data transfer. The design includes colors and codes to help users pick the right one. This stops wrong connections.

    FAKRA A is used for radios. FAKRA F works with car cameras and video signals. Each connector type fits its job, but FAKRA Z is best for high-frequency use.
